I recently discovered Zach Horn's work at Tselaine in Philadelphia, and was immediately struck by the layering and dynamic color of his paintings. If only I had the money to drop on one of these stunning pieces, I totally would. Zach is graduate of U. Penn, but now lives in New York City.
[from artist's website: ARTIST STATEMENT - I see the world in abstract terms. I see chaos in the patterns on buildings and in the movements of people on the sidewalk. I have seen it in schools of fish off the coast of Panama and I have witnessed abstraction in the mountains of Argentina. I see abstraction because the world is infinitely more complex than a painting could be. Therefore, to try to capture the world on canvas is either an illusion or a mistake.]
